Abstract :
We demonstrate a Nd-doped fiber laser passively mode-locked with semiconductor saturable absorber in the 894-909 nm spectral range. Self-started operation has been achieved in soliton-supporting dispersion regime, generating 360-fs pulses, and in stretched-pulse mode-locking regime.
